Description
A golden-brown, tender turkey breast cooked in the air fryer, delivering juicy results in record time. Perfect for busy weeknights or comforting family meals, with a crispy exterior and flavorful seasoning.
Ingredients
1 boneless turkey breast (5–6 pounds)
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1 teaspoon dried rosemary
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
Instructions
Pat turkey breast dry with paper towels
Drizzle olive oil over the turkey and spread evenly
In a small bowl, mix gar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, rosemary, thyme, salt, and black pepper
Rub seasoning mixture over all surfaces of the turkey
Preheat air fryer to 370°F (185°C)
Place turkey breast in the air fryer basket and cook for 40-50 minutes, basting occasionally with its juices
Insert a meat thermometer into the thickest part of the breast for doneness (165°F/74°C)
Let rest for 10 minutes before slicing
Notes
Use bone-in turkey breast for added moisture if available
Basting with juices enhances flavor
For extra richness, add a pat of butter on top during last 5 minutes of cooking
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days
